Output 662f3d34ce3bb5b55448fd204db2aecdd4c4ddd9ab4eaeaa79f5c08c0880ddae:1

value
427271730
script pubkey
OP_0 OP_PUSHBYTES_20 d53ff8fc1645d6b9d29dd23edbc138119e189050
address
bc1q65ll3lqkghttn55a6gldhsfczx0p3yzscwjss4
transaction
662f3d34ce3bb5b55448fd204db2aecdd4c4ddd9ab4eaeaa79f5c08c0880ddae
confirmations
54212
spent
true